A company accountant is responsible for managing and overseeing the financial activities of an organization. Their main duties include preparing financial statements, analyzing and interpreting financial data, ensuring compliance with tax regulations, and providing recommendations for improving financial performance. They are also involved in budgeting, forecasting, and monitoring cash flow to ensure the company's financial stability. In addition, they may assist with audits, manage payroll, and handle financial reporting.

Company Accountant salary in Switzerland
Average Yearly Salary of Company Accountant in Switzerland is approximately 107,570 CHF (107,595 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 78,716 CHF (86,670 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Company Accountant job salary compared to average salary in Switzerland.
Comparison shows that a person working as Company Accountant in Switzerland earns on average:
1.37 times the average salary (or 137% of average salary).
